如何使用 CSS 使任何 SVG 图像灰度化?

问题描述 投票:0回答:1

我有一些带有 svg 扩展名的图像。我需要以灰度模式获取这些图像。是否可以仅使用 css 或我可以对文件或

<svg>
标签本身执行的任何操作来完成此操作?我不想使用在线工具进行此转换,我需要纯样式“工具”,例如 html css js。我读过,向
<img>
标签添加类可能会有所帮助。顺便说一句,我需要它的原始质量,所以把它变成灰色是唯一的目标。

html css image svg grayscale
1个回答
3
投票

使用

<img>
和 CSS 函数
grayscale()

<img src="img.svg" style="filter: grayscale(1);"/>
© www.soinside.com 2019 - 2024. All rights reserved.